module Make (Encoding : Resto.ENCODING) = struct
  open Cohttp

  type t = {
    name : Cohttp.Accept.media_range;
    q : int option;
    pp : 'a. 'a Encoding.t -> Format.formatter -> string -> unit;
    construct : 'a. 'a Encoding.t -> 'a -> string;
    construct_seq : 'a. 'a Encoding.t -> 'a -> (Bytes.t * int * int) Seq.t;
    destruct : 'a. 'a Encoding.t -> string -> ('a, string) result;
  }

  let name_of_media_type = function
    | Accept.AnyMedia ->
        "*/*"
    | AnyMediaSubtype type_ ->
        type_ ^ "/*"
    | MediaType (type_, subtype) ->
        type_ ^ "/" ^ subtype

  let name {name; _} = name_of_media_type name

  let rec has_complete_media = function
    | [] ->
        false
    | {name = MediaType _; _} :: _ ->
        true
    | _ :: l ->
        has_complete_media l

  let rec first_complete_media = function
    | [] ->
        None
    | ({name = MediaType (l, r); _} as m) :: _ ->
        Some ((l, r), m)
    | _ :: l ->
        first_complete_media l

  let matching_media (type_, subtype) = function
    | Accept.AnyMedia ->
        true
    | AnyMediaSubtype type_' ->
        type_' = type_
    | MediaType (type_', subtype') ->
        type_' = type_ && subtype' = subtype

  let rec find_media received = function
    | [] ->
        None
    | ({name; _} as media) :: _ when matching_media received name ->
        Some media
    | _ :: mts ->
        find_media received mts

  (* Inspired from ocaml-webmachine *)

  let media_match (_, (range, _)) media =
    match media.name with
    | AnyMedia | AnyMediaSubtype _ ->
        false
    | MediaType (type_, subtype) -> (
        let open Accept in
        match range with
        | AnyMedia ->
            true
        | AnyMediaSubtype type_' ->
            type_' = type_
        | MediaType (type_', subtype') ->
            type_' = type_ && subtype' = subtype )

  let resolve_accept_header provided header =
    let ranges = Accept.(media_ranges header |> qsort) in
    let rec loop = function
      | [] ->
          None
      | r :: rs -> (
        try
          let media = List.find (media_match r) provided in
          Some (name_of_media_type media.name, media)
        with Not_found -> loop rs )
    in
    loop ranges

  let accept_header ranges =
    let ranges =
      List.map
        (fun r ->
          let q = match r.q with None -> 1000 | Some i -> i in
          (q, (r.name, [])))
        ranges
    in
    Accept.string_of_media_ranges ranges

  let acceptable_encoding ranges =
    String.concat ", " (List.map (fun f -> name_of_media_type f.name) ranges)
end
